NIOBIUM and ALLOY PLATE, SHEET and STRIP, CONT., P. 3

3.4 Bend Ductility. Representative samples of the materials in final form shall withstand the following bend test at room temperatures without failure when tested according to procedures described in the most recent revision of the Materials Advisory Board report MAB-216-M, "Evaluation Test Methods for Refractory Metal Sheet Materials." The samples shall be sectioned with the long axis of the bend specimens perpendicular to the final rolling direction.

3.4.1 Sheet 0.060" in thickness and under shall be bent over a 1T radius through 105 degrees at a ram speed of one inch/per minute.

3.4.2 Sheet over 0.060" to 0.187" in thickness shall be bent over a 1T radius through 105 degrees at a ram speed of one inch/per minute.

3.5 Grain Size. Unless otherwise specified, the minimum average ASTM grain size number shall be in accordance with Table IV.

Table IV.

Thickness C-1O3 C-129Y Nb-1Zr Cb-752
.006-.150" 6 6 5  6
.151-.500" 5 5 4  5

4 Dimensions and Tolerances

4.1 Dimensions and Tolerances. Unless otherwise specified, tolerances shall be as defined in AMS 2242.

4.2 Flatness. Total deviation from flatness of sheet and strip shall not exceed 6% as determined by the following formula: H/L X 100 = percent of flatness deviation. where H = maximum distance from a flat reference deviation. and L = minimum distance from this point to the point of contact with the reference surface.

4.3 Marking for Identification. Each plate, sheet, and strip shall be suitably marked with the contract number or order number, ingot melt number, specification number, and composition number.

5. Quality

5.1 General. The finished product shall be visibly free from oxide or scale of any nature, grease, oil residual lubricants, and other extraneous materials. Cracks, laps, seams, gouges, and fins shall be unacceptable.

5.2 Surface Rework. All surface pores, gouges, and other defects deeper than 0.005" or 3% of the thickness, whichever is smaller, shall be unacceptable. Sunace imperfections may be faired smooth to remove any notch effect provided dimensional tolerances are still maintained.

5.3 Edge. The edges shall be produced by shearing, slitting or sawing. The burr height shall not exceed five (5) percent of the thickness of the material.
